Risk Factors for Atherosclerosis Factors related to a twofold or greater risk of ischemic heart disease embody: Hypertension: High blood pressure increases the chance of myocardial infarction. Recent evidence signifies that each diastolic and systolic hypertension contribute equally to this increased danger. Men with systolic blood pressures over one hundred sixty mm Hg have virtually triple the incidence of myocardial infarction compared to these with systolic pressures beneath a hundred and twenty mm Hg. The use of antihypertensive drugs has significantly decreased myocardial infarction and stroke. Blood cholesterol level: Serum levels of cholesterol correlate with growth of ischemic coronary heart illness and account for much of the geographic variation in the incidence of this situation. Absent genetic disorders of lipid metabolism (see below), blood cholesterol correlates strongly with dietary consumption of saturated fats. Cigarette smoking: Coronary and aortic atherosclerosis are extra extreme and extensive in cigarette people who smoke than in nonsmokers, and the effect is dose related (see Chapter 8). Thus, smoking markedly will increase the danger of myocardial infarction, ischemic stroke and stomach aortic aneurysms. Diabetes: Diabetics are at elevated threat for occlusive atherosclerotic vascular disease in lots of organs. Increasing age and male intercourse: Both correlate strongly with the danger of myocardial infarction, but in all probability as reflections of amassed results of other threat factors. Homocysteine: Homocystinuria is a rare autosomal recessive illness brought on by mutations in the gene encoding cystathionine synthase. Mild elevations of plasma homocysteine are widespread and are an independent threat issue for atherosclerosis of the coronary arteries and other large vessels. The increased risk is analogous in magnitude to these of smoking and hyperlipidemia. Homocysteine is toxic to endothelial cells and impairs several anticoagulant mechanisms in endothelial cells. In addition, oxidative interactions between homocysteine, lipoproteins and cholesterol additional complicate the scenario. The disease develops from an initial genetic susceptibility to faulty recognition of beta cell epitopes and ends with primarily full beta cell destruction in most patients. Patients with islet cell antibodies and normal blood glucose ranges are thought of to have a state of "pre�type 1 diabetes. Depending on the diploma of absolute insulin deficiency, severe ketoacidosis may be preceded by weeks to months of elevated urine output (polyuria) and elevated thirst (polydipsia). Weight loss in spite of elevated urge for food (polyphagia) outcomes from unregulated catabolism of physique shops of fat, protein and carbohydrate. It has been harder to show that glucose management can prevent "macrovascular" (large-vessel) complications, that means atherosclerosis and its sequelae (coronary artery disease, peripheral vascular illness and cerebrovascular disease). Proposed mediators of glucose-induced oxidative damage embrace nitric oxide, superoxide anions and aldose reductase (see Chapter 1). Numerous cellular proteins are modified in this manner, together with hemoglobin, elements of the crystalline lens and mobile basement membrane proteins. A specific fraction of glycated hemoglobin in circulating purple blood cells, hemoglobin A1c, is used routinely to monitor the general diploma of hyperglycemia in the course of the previous 6�8 weeks. Because glycation of hemoglobin is irreversible, hemoglobin A1c levels function a marker for glycemic control. The initial glycation products (known chemically as Schiff bases) are labile and may dissociate quickly. Aldose reductase has a low affinity for glucose, however it generates considerable amounts of sorbitol in tissues when blood glucose is elevated. In the ocular lens, extra sorbitol could simply create an osmotic gradient that causes influx of fluid and consequent swelling. Increased intracellular sorbitol has been linked to decreased myoinositol (a precursor of phosphoinositides), decrease protein kinase C exercise and inhibition of the plasma membrane sodium pump. However, inhibition of aldose reductase shows no benefit in human scientific trials, so the roles of aldose reductase and sorbitol within the problems of diabetes is unclear. Atherosclerosis Is a Deadly Complication of Diabetes Atherosclerotic coronary heart disease and ischemic strokes account for over half of all deaths among adults with diabetes. The extent and severity of atherosclerotic lesions in mediumsized and huge arteries are elevated in patients with longstanding diabetes. Diabetes eliminates the usual protective effect of being female, and coronary artery illness develops at a youthful age than in nondiabetic people. Moreover, mortality from myocardial infarction is higher in diabetics than in nondiabetics. Atherosclerotic peripheral vascular disease, significantly of the decrease extremities, commonly complicates diabetes. Vascular insufficiency might cause ulcers and gangrene of the toes and toes, in the end necessitating amputation. Diabetes accounts for greater than 60% of nontraumatic limb amputations within the United States. Flatworms (trematodes) are dorsoventrally flattened organisms with digestive tracts that finish in blind loops. Tapeworms (cestodes) are segmented organisms with separate head and body components; they lack a digestive tract and take in nutrients via their outer walls. Lymphatic vessels harboring adult worms are dilated, and their endothelial lining is thickened. In adjoining tissues, worms are surrounded by chronic irritation, including eosinophils. A granulomatous response could develop, and degenerating worms can provoke acute irritation. Microfilariae are seen in blood vessels and lymphatics, and degenerating microfilariae also provoke a chronic inflammatory response. After repeated bouts of lymphangitis, lymph nodes and lymphatics become densely fibrotic, typically containing calcified remnants of the worms. Adult worms inhabit the lymphatics, most frequently in inguinal, epitrochlear and axillary lymph nodes, testis and epididymis. There they cause acute lymphangitis and, in a minority of contaminated subjects, lymphatic obstruction, leading to severe lymphedema. These and similar organisms are often known as filarial worms, due to their threadlike appearance (from the Latin filum, meaning "thread"). A smaller number develop recurrent episodes of filarial fevers, with malaise, lymphadenopathy and lymphangitis, which persist for 1�2 weeks and then resolve spontaneously. In a small subset, late manifestations of disease appear after two to three a long time of recurrent bouts of filarial fevers. Diethylcarbamazine and ivermectin are the agents efficient in opposition to lymphatic filariasis. Striking examples of environmental influence on genetic predisposition embrace the Pima Native Americans in Arizona and the Aboriginal population of northern Australia. Pimas are now largely sedentary and eat a food regimen during which 50% of vitality derives from fat, not like their traditional low-fat diets. By distinction, the genetically related Pimas within the Sierra Madre Mountains of Northern Mexico are extra physically active, keep more traditional low-fat diets and have a lot lower rates of weight problems and kind 2 diabetes. Urbanized Aboriginal individuals in Australia have a high prevalence of diabetes and hypertriglyceridemia, compared with their nonurbanized counterparts. As little as a 7-week reexposure of urbanized Aboriginals with diabetes and hypertriglyceridemia to traditional lifestyle- eating much less and transferring more-led to weight reduction and improved glucose tolerance, blood glucose, insulin and triglycerides. Regarding heritable predisposition, diabetes danger among the many Pima group varies inversely with the extent of European ancestry in each. There are main anatomic limitations to infection-the skin and the aerodynamic filtration system of the higher airway-that stop most organisms from ever penetrating the body. The mucociliary blanket of the airways can also be an essential defense, expelling organisms that achieve access to the respiratory system. Microbial flora normally resident within the gastrointestinal tract and in numerous physique orifices compete with exterior organisms, stopping them from gaining sufficient vitamins or binding sites in the host. Age Is Important in Predicting Susceptibility to Many Infections the effect of age on the finish result of exposure to many infectious agents is nicely illustrated by infections of the fetus. Normally, the fetus is protected by maternal IgG (generated by a specific previous infection) that passively crosses the placenta. In acute an infection of a pregnant woman who lacks neutralizing antibody, sure pathogens could cross the placenta. These infections are usually subclinical or produce minimal illness within the mom. Depending on the organism and timing of exposure, fetal infection can produce minimal injury, main congenital abnormalities or demise. Age also impacts the course of common diseases, such as the varied viral and bacterial diarrheas. In older kids and adults, these infections trigger discomfort and inconvenience, but not often severe disease. Other examples embody infection with Mycobacterium tuberculosis, which produces extreme, disseminated tuberculosis in kids underneath the age of 3 years. Varicella-zoster virus causes chickenpox in children however produces extra extreme illness in adults, who usually have a tendency to develop viral pneumonia. Common respiratory illnesses such as influenza and pneumococcal pneumonia are extra typically fatal in those older than sixty five. The case fatality fee was lower than 1% for folks youthful than 24 years, however was larger than 50% for these over 65 years. These infections occur in farmers, herders, meat processors and, within the case of brucellosis, people who drink unpasteurized milk. Schistosomiasis is acquired when water-borne parasite larvae penetrate the skin of a prone host. It is primarily a illness of farmers who work in fields irrigated by contaminated water. The larvae of hookworm and Strongyloides stercoralis live in humid soil and penetrate the pores and skin of the toes in people who stroll barefoot. Shoes are in all probability the single most important consider limiting an infection with soil-transmitted nematodes. Anisakiasis and diphyllobothriasis are helminthic ailments acquired by consuming incompletely cooked fish. Toxoplasmosis is a protozoan infection transmitted from animals to people by ingestion of incompletely cooked, infected meat or by publicity to infected cat feces. Botulism, a meals poisoning brought on by a bacterial toxin, is contracted by ingestion of improperly canned food that incorporates the toxin. As people change their conduct, they open up new potentialities for infectious illnesses. Although the agent of Legionnaires illness is widespread in the environment, aerosols generated by cooling plants, faucets and humidifiers provide the means for inflicting human infections. Damage to epithelial surfaces by trauma or burns can result in invasive bacterial or fungal infections. Injury to the airway mucociliary apparatus, as in smoking or influenza, impairs clearance of inhaled microorganisms and provides rise to an elevated incidence of bacterial pneumonia. Congenital absence of sure complement components prevents formation of a fully useful membrane attack complicated and permits disseminated, and infrequently recurrent, Neisseria infections (see Chapter 2). Diseases corresponding to diabetes mellitus and the use of chemotherapeutic medication and corticosteroids might interfere with neutrophil manufacturing or perform and enhance the chance and severity of infections with micro organism or fungi. Compromised hosts are often attacked by organisms that are innocuous to regular folks. For instance, patients poor in neutrophils regularly develop life-threatening bloodstream infections with commensal microorganisms that usually populate the skin and gastrointestinal tract.
